MARSHALL, Texas – No. 6 Birmingham-Southern softball upset host No. 2 East Texas Baptist to stay alive at the Marshall Regional of the NCAA Tournament Friday night. BSC defeated ETBU 7-4 in the night cap after falling to No. 6 Texas Lutheran 2-0 in game one.
The Panthers 21 win streak was snapped with the loss.
No. 2 East Texas Baptist (39-5) 4, No. 6 Birmingham-Southern (35-6) 7
Haley Crumpton (Alabaster, Ala./Thompson HS) led the team at the plate and in the circle. She went 2-for-3, including a double, with an RBI and struck out four in 6.1 innings work, giving up just one earned run to earn the win. Saydee Keith (Corner, Ala./Corner HS), Annie Clayton (Eufaula, Ala./Eufaula HS), Kyser, and Alyssa Fowler (Moody, Ala./Moody HS) also had hits. Bailey Murphy (Trussville, Ala./Hewitt-Trussville HS) and Keith led the team with two RBI each.
Birmingham-Southern 0, No. 8 Texas Lutheran (31-7) 2
The Panthers were unable to find an answer to TLU's Kayla Oliveira in the circle. Abby Spencer (Auburn, Ala./Auburn HS) and Clayton earned BSC's only hits. Crumpton went six innings, striking out four and walking just one batter in the loss.
